"A stunning individually designed and extended, true detached bungalow set on a private road within a generous plot of around 0.49 of an acre. This beautiful home has undergone a series of modernisations and extensions to create a truly fabulous place to bring up a family. Entering the property via the porch to the welcoming lounge with an inset remote controlled gas fire with beautiful limestone feature surround. At either side of the lounge there are doors which open up to both the kitchen and the fabulous sun room with skylights, wood burning stove and bi fold doors leading to the patio area. When both of the lounge doors are open you have a wonderful entertaining space that stretches the full length of the property. Just off the kitchen there is a handy utility area which has a door, currently blocked off, into the annexe which can easily be reinstated if needed. The inner hallway leads to a four piece family bathroom and to four double bedrooms, three of which have en suites with the main bedroom also benefitting from a super walk in wardrobe and bi fold doors which leads out onto the patio area complete with sunken hot tub. The fifth bedroom is currently within the annexe and has dual zone underfloor heating giving the potential to split the room in two if necessary. The annexe also has an en suite shower room and is ideal for a member of family or perhaps guests. Externally the property has superb gardens to the rear and side with a sizeable lawn area, perfect for children to play on. The patio captures all the sun and has an inset hot tub which is perfect to wind down after a busy day. Additionally there is a plot of land as you approach the property which could potentially be developed with a garage subject to the relevant planning permissions. The property is located within the highly sought after desirable area of Egerton and is close to many local amenities including cafe s, pubs and schools such as Walmsley C.E Primary, Egerton C.P. School and Turton school in Bromley Cross. Also within close proximity are many fabulous restaurants and sporting clubs to include Dunscar Golf Club, Egerton Cricket Club, Delph Sailing Club and The Last Drop Village with the added benefit of reservoirs and beautiful countryside to be explored on foot or bicycle.
